Hampstead H3X 1X8 Website Design and Programming
Hampstead Quebec H3X 1X8
Hampstead Quebec
PostalCode 45.481235 Longitude -73.649138
Website Design, Programming, SEO and Lead Generation
Hampstead Quebec H3X 1X8
Hampstead Quebec
PostalCode 45.481235 Longitude -73.649138